WebbDuring conidiation, the Slt2-MAPK phosphorylates the serine at the position 306 in RNS1. WebbMitogen-activated protein (MAP) kinase Slt2 is a key player in the cell-wall integrity pathway of budding yeast. In this study, we functionally characterized Slt2 orthologs … WebbThe Slt2-MAPK/RNS1 cascade represents a novel regulatory mechanism of the central regulatory pathway during conidiation.
